5 Easy Steps to Creating a PDF Download Link That Works Every Time!

Welcome to our blog, where we empower users with practical tech skills. Today, we’re delving into the world of PDFs, providing you a simple guide on how to create a PDF download link. Follow along and level-up your digital savvy!

Creating a PDF Download Link: A Step-by-Step Software Guide

Adding a PDF download link to your webpage or application is a crucial feature that enhances user interactivity and satisfaction. This feature allows users to download and save important files for future references. Here’s a step-by-step guide to walk you through the process:

Step 1: Uploading Your PDF File
Before creating a download link, you first need to upload the PDF file to your server. This can be done using an FTP client such as FileZilla. Simply connect to your server, navigate to the directory where you want to store the file, and upload it.

Step 2: Copying the URL of Your Uploaded PDF File
After uploading the file, you should copy its direct URL for later use. The URL structure usually looks like this: http://yourwebsite.com/yourdirectory/yourfile.pdf.

Step 3: Creating an HTML Link
Once you’ve copied the URL of the PDF file, the next step is to create an HTML link. This can be done using the following syntax: Link text. Replace “URL” with the link you copied in step 2, and “Link text” with the text you want to display to users.

Step 4: Making the HTML Link Downloadable
By default, an HTML link will open the PDF file in a new browser tab. If you want the link to download the PDF file instead, you need to add the ‘download’ attribute to your link. The syntax should look like this: Link text.

Here is how these steps come together:
Let’s say you want to create a download link for a PDF file called “example.pdf” that you’ve uploaded to a folder called “documents” on your website. The link to the file would be http://yourwebsite.com/documents/example.pdf. To create a downloadable link, your HTML code would look like this:

Download Example PDF.

This will create a link that says “Download Example PDF”. When users click this link, they will automatically download the example.pdf file.

How can I create a PDF download link using HTML?

Creating a PDF download link using HTML is a straightforward task.

Here are the steps to follow:

1. Upload your PDF file: The first step is to upload your PDF file to your web hosting server. You can do this using File Transfer Protocol (FTP) software such as FileZilla or via your web host’s control panel.

2. Get the URL of the PDF: Next, you need to get the URL of the PDF file. This will typically be your website address followed by the path to where your PDF is stored. For example, if your website is www.example.com and you have saved your PDF in a folder called ‘downloads’, the URL would be www.example.com/downloads/myPDF.pdf.

3. Create the download link: Now you’re ready to create the download link. In an HTML document, this is done with the `` or anchor tag. The `href` attribute specifies the URL of the page the link goes to.

Here is an example of how to structure your HTML code to create a PDF download link:

Click here to download the PDF

In this example, ‘Click here to download the PDF’ is the link text that people will see on your webpage. When clicked, this link will trigger a download of the PDF file.

The `download` attribute is optional. If you include it, the browser will start downloading the file as soon as the link is clicked. If you leave it out, the browser will open the PDF file in a new tab.

4. Save and Test: Finally, save your HTML file and open it in a web browser to test the link. It should open or download the PDF file when clicked.

Those are all the steps you need to create a PDF download link using HTML. Good luck!

How can I generate a download link for a PDF in an email?

To generate a download link for a PDF in an email, you have to first upload your PDF file to an online hosting service. This can be your own server or a third party host such as Google Drive, Dropbox, or OneDrive.

Here’s a general guide on how you can do this:

1. Upload the PDF: For this example, let’s use Google Drive. Upload your PDF file to your Google Drive account by clicking on “+ New” and then “File upload”. Select your PDF file from your computer.

2. Set Permissions: Once the upload is complete, right click on the PDF file and select “Share”. Under ‘Get Link’, ensure the setting is set on ‘Anyone with the link’. Click ‘Copy link’.

3. Create the Download Link: The copied URL will lead users to view the PDF in their web browser. To make it a download link, replace “open?” in the URL with “uc?export=download&”. Now your URL should look something like “.com/uc?export=download&id=YourIndividualID”.

To place this download link in an email, you’ll need to create an HTML anchor tag. Here’s how you do that:

Click here to download

Replace the “your_direct_URL_here” with the direct link you’ve created in Step 3. When the recipient clicks on this link in the email, they would be able to download the PDF file directly.

How can I share a PDF file as a link?

Sure, sharing a PDF file as a link involves the following steps:

1. Upload the PDF File to a Cloud Storage Service: The first step in sharing your PDF file as a link is to upload the file to a cloud storage service such as Google Drive, Dropbox, or Microsoft OneDrive. This will allow you to generate a shareable link.

2. Generate a Shareable Link: Once the PDF file is uploaded, you want to generate a shareable link. To do this on Google Drive, for example, right-click on the file and select “Get shareable link”. In Dropbox, you would also right click the file, select ‘Share’, then ‘Create a link‘. For OneDrive, right click the file, select ‘Share‘, then ‘Copy link‘.

3. Adjusting Access Permissions: When generating the shareable link, make sure the permissions are set so the people with the link can view the file. On Google Drive, Dropbox, and OneDrive, you can set this by selecting ‘Anyone with the link can view‘ when creating the link.

4. Sharing the Link: After generating the link and adjusting the access permissions, you can now share it. Simply paste the link in an email, text message, or any other form of communication.

Remember, whenever you share content online, it’s important to keep in mind the privacy and security implications, especially if the PDF contains sensitive information. Be cautious about who you share the link with, and make use of the security settings provided by your chosen cloud service.

“What are the steps to create a PDF download link in HTML?”

Creating a PDF download link in HTML follows a simple and straightforward process. This will allow users to download a PDF document directly from your website.

Please follow the steps below:

Step 1: Upload the PDF file to your hosting service. This could be through FTP, or any file manager that your hosting service provides.

Step 2: After uploading, get the URL of the PDF file. The URL is usually the path to your PDF file on your server.

Step 3: On your HTML page where you want the download link to appear, use the anchor tag `` to create a hyperlink.

Step 4: Set the `href` attribute of the anchor tag to the URL of your uploaded PDF file. For example, if the URL to your PDF file is `https://example.com/myfile.pdf`, then the tag would look like: ``.

Step 5: You can customize the text that the user clicks on to start the download by adding it between the opening `` tag and the closing `` tag. For example, `Download my PDF`.

The ending HTML code will look something like this: `Download my PDF`

The ‘download’ attribute tells the browser to download the linked resource rather than navigating to it. It’s optional and may not work in all browsers, so it’s always best to test this out to ensure that your users are getting the intended experience.

“Can you explain how to make a PDF download link in WordPress?”

Absolutely, making a PDF download link in WordPress is quite straightforward. Here’s a step-by-step guide:

1. Upload the PDF File to Your WordPress Site: Log into your WordPress admin area and go to ‘Media’. Click on the ‘Add New’ button and then select the PDF document from your device to upload.

2. Get the URL of the Uploaded PDF File: After uploading the PDF file, you will see its thumbnail. Click on the ‘Edit’ link under it. This will open the attachment details popup where you will see the ‘Copy Link’ button. Click on the button to copy the PDF file URL.

3. Create or Edit a Post: Now that you have the PDF URL, you can create a new post or edit an existing one where you want to add the PDF download link.

4. Add the Download Link: In your post editor, select the text that you want to make into a download link and click on the ‘Insert Link’ button in the WordPress editor. This will bring up an insert link popup where you need to paste the copied PDF URL.

5. Make Your Link Downloadable: If you want users to download the PDF instead of viewing it in their browser, you can add ‘download’ to the end of your link. For example, your link should now look like this: `` This code tells the browser to download the clicked file instead of navigating to it.

6. After all this, just click ‘Update’ or ‘Publish’ on your post. Your PDF download link should now work perfectly.

Remember, ensuring your website’s security and efficiency is paramount, so always keep your WordPress version updated and check your website performance after uploading heavy PDF files.

“How can I use JavaScript to create a PDF download link?”

Sure! Here are the steps to create a PDF download link using JavaScript.

1. Include the necessary scripts:

Firstly, you need to include the `jspdf` library in your HTML file. This library allows for generating PDFs in JavaScript.


2. Add an HTML element:

Create an HTML element to serve as the download link, and give it an ID so we can easily access it with JavaScript later.

Download PDF

3. Write the JavaScript code:

Now, let’s write the JavaScript code that creates a new `jsPDF` instance, add some text to our PDF, and finally, makes our HTML element a download link for this PDF.

document.getElementById(‘download’).addEventListener(‘click’, function() {
var doc = new jsPDF();
doc.text(‘Hello world!’, 10, 10);
The `addEventListener` method is used to attach an event handler to the ‘Download PDF’ link. When this link is clicked, a new PDF document is created, some text is added, and the `save` method is called to download the file named ‘sample.pdf’.

And that’s it. Clicking the ‘Download PDF’ link will now download a PDF file with “Hello world!” text.

Please make sure to use this appropriately, considering that creating lots of unnecessary files or using it in a malicious manner might lead to issues.

“Is it possible to generate a PDF download link using Python?”

Yes, it is entirely possible to generate a PDF download link using Python. You can use various libraries in Python, such as PDFkit and wkhtmltopdf.

To install these libraries, you will need to use pip:

– For PDFkit: `pip install pdfkit`
– For wkhtmltopdf: download the installer from the official page.

Here’s a simple example of how to use PDFkit:

import pdfkit

pdfkit.from_url(‘http://google.com’, ‘out.pdf’)

In the snippet above, we first import the `pdfkit` library, then use the `from_url()` method to generate a PDF file from Google’s homepage, saving it as `out.pdf`.

Note: The ‘wkhtmltopdf’ needs to be installed in a location that Python can access. It can usually achieve this by adding it to your system’s PATH or specify its location directly when initialize pdfkit config.

This will generate a PDF from the given URL. However, if you want to generate a download link for a PDF file, you might need to consider setting up a web server and serve the generated PDFs from there. Python has several frameworks to help with this, like Flask or Django.

“Does PHP provide any functionality to create a PDF download link?”

Yes, PHP does indeed provide functionality for creating a PDF download link. This can be achieved by using a special PHP library known as Fpdf, as well as other libraries such as TCPDF and Dompdf.

The Fpdf library allows you to generate PDF files using simple PHP scripts without any external dependencies on PDF libraries. It’s easy to use and functional, but you have to manually control the positioning and design of the elements, which can be time-consuming for complex documents.

To create a PDF download link, you would typically generate the PDF file on your server using PHP, save it to a file in a public directory, and then provide a regular HTML link to that file.

Here is a simple example:


$pdf = new FPDF();
$pdf->SetFont(‘Arial’, ‘B’, 16);
$pdf->Cell(40, 10, ‘Hello World!’);
$pdf->Output(‘F’, ‘hello_world.pdf’);

You’d then include a link to `hello_world.pdf` in your HTML:

Download PDF

Remember to ensure your web server is configured to allow PDFs to be downloaded. Also take care to securely generate and store these PDFs, especially if they contain sensitive data.

“What is the best practice to create a secure PDF download link?”

The provision of a secure PDF download link requires adherence to several best practices in order to maintain the integrity and safety of your data. Here is a step-by-step guide:

1. Secure the PDF File: First, you should always make sure your PDF files are secured. This can be achieved by encrypting the PDF file before uploading it. Most PDF creation software, like Adobe Acrobat, allows you to password protect your files.

2. Use SSL: Always ensure that your website is SSL secured. SSL (Secure Socket Layer) is a standard security protocol for establishing encrypted links between a web server and a browser in an online communication. This will also help to protect user information if you require users to fill in details before downloading the PDF.

3. Secure Directories: Protect your directories on the server where the PDFs are stored. Only authorized personnel should have access to these directories to prevent unauthorized distribution or alteration of your PDFs.

4. Temporary Download Links: Generate temporary download links for each user. This ensures that the link can only be used once, or for a set period of time, providing additional security against unauthorized sharing.

5. Access Control: Implement access control mechanisms such as user authentication or CAPTCHA validation. This will restrict the access to your PDF files.

6. Monitor and Log Downloads: Regularly monitor and log downloads. This will help you keep track of who is downloading your files, when they’re downloaded, and from what location.

Remember, the priority is to keep your content safe while still making it easily accessible to authorized users.

“How can I track the number of downloads from a PDF link?”

There are few methods to track the number of downloads from a PDF link in the context of software. Let’s consider some of them:

1. Google Analytics Event Tracking:
Google Analytics is a versatile tool that you can use to track the user’s behavior on your website. By using its event tracking capability, you can simply track how many times a specific PDF file was downloaded. You have to add a piece of code to the link of the PDF file you want to track.

2. Using Server Logs:
Another method to track the number of downloads from a PDF link is by analyzing server logs. Your website’s server should log every request made to it, including downloads of PDF files. This method requires access to and understanding of server logs and possibly scripting or programming to automating the process of analyzing the logs.

3. Directly from CMS or website builder:
Some Content Management Systems (CMS) or website builders have built-in analytics that can track downloads. Check to see if your system has this functionality.

Remember that privacy laws and regulations apply to this kind of data collection, so make sure you are compliant with any applicable laws.